Video network brings city expertise to Montana’s rural health care facilities

The REACH Network is a video conferencing system that links 18 health care facilities across Northcentral Montana and the Hi-Line.

Hardin, Montana wants its empty jail to be new Gitmo

The development authority in Hardin, a city of 3,400 people bordering the Crow Indian Reservation, built the $27 million, 460-bed jail two years ago and has been looking for tenants ever since. Its construction loans are in default.
